Computers for gaming are specially designed to deliver high-performance capabilities to meet the demands of modern video games. Here are some key aspects to consider when looking for gaming computers:

  1. Graphics Processing Unit (GPU): A powerful GPU is crucial for gaming performance. High-end GPUs from companies like NVIDIA and AMD provide smooth graphics and better gaming experiences.

  2. Central Processing Unit (CPU): A capable CPU is essential for overall system performance. Many modern games benefit from multi-core processors, so a quad-core or higher CPU is often recommended.

  3. RAM (Random Access Memory): Games, especially newer titles, can be resource-intensive. Having an ample amount of RAM, typically 8GB or more, ensures smoother gameplay and multitasking.

  4. Storage: Gaming computers often use SSDs (Solid State Drives) for faster loading times. Additionally, having sufficient storage space is important for storing large game files.

  5. Motherboard: The motherboard connects and manages all the components. Look for a motherboard that supports the chosen CPU and has the necessary expansion slots.

  6. Power Supply Unit (PSU): A sufficient and reliable power supply is crucial. Gaming computers with high-end components may require a higher wattage PSU.

  7. Cooling System: Intensive gaming can generate heat, so a robust cooling solution is essential. This can include air or liquid cooling systems to keep temperatures in check.

  8. Case: A well-designed case not only looks good but also provides proper airflow for cooling.It should have sufficient space for components and cable management.

  9. Peripherals: Gaming peripherals such as a gaming keyboard, mouse, and monitor contribute to the overall gaming experience.
